Budget 2019: Govt should come up with the budget which is growth oriented for MSMEs

New Delhi, 28 June (KNN) Government should come up with the budget  which is growth oriented for Micro Small and Medium Enterprises (MSMEs) sector, said Manmohan Gaind President of Manesar Industries Welfare Association (MIWA).

While sharing the expectations with KNN India on budget 2019, he said MSMEs are looking for support from the government in the form of interest subvention because the liquidity in MSMEs is the biggest challenge and if we can get lesser rate of interest in our loans it will help us in growing our businesses.

He said that we can generate some capital by selling our residential property so whatever capital gains we accrued can be used in using the industrial plot now they don’t allow that, instead they want us to buy the residential property which is not the good this so we have asked in change in that law also.

Finance minister Nirmala Sitharaman will present her maiden budget on July 5, 2019.
